Features of your new Refrigerator Key features of your new refrigerator Your Samsung Refrigerator comes equipped with various innovative storage and energy-efficient features. • Twin Cooling System The Refrigerator and Freezer have separate evaporators. Due to this independent cooling system, the Freezer and Refrigerator cool more efficiently. Additionally, this separate air flow system prevents food odor of one compartment from seeping into other compartments.

Operating your SAMSUNG Refrigerator USING THE CONTROL PANEL 1 2 3 4 5 6 Temperature & Function select / control panel ( 1 ) Ice Off Button When the Ice Off Button is pressed, ice will not be produced. Use this function only when it is needed. ( 2 ) Power Freeze Button Press this button to freeze food quickly. (Power Freeze will last 2 and a half hours.) ( 3 ) Freezer Button Freezer temperature set button. Press this button to set the Freezer temp between -14ºC and -22ºC.
CONTROLLING THE TEMPERATURE 02 operating Setting the freezer temperature If you want to control the freezer temperature, follow as below. Press the Freezer Button (Refer the picture) - The temperature can be set in 1ºC interval between -22ºC and -14ºC. When selecting the temperature, the set temperature is displayed initially for 5 seconds, then the actual temperature is displayed.

Ice Maker Operation 02 operating The ice maker will produce 8 cubes per cycle - approximately 100~130 cubes in a 24-hour period, depending on freezer compartment temperature, room temperature, number of door openings and other use conditions. Throw away the first few batches of ice to allow the water line to clear. Be sure nothing interferes with the sweep of the feeler arm. When the bin fills to the level of the feeler arm, the icemaker will stop producing ice.

CLEANING THE REFRIGERATOR Caring for your Samsung Refrigerator prolongs the life of your appliance and helps keep it odor and germ-free. 02 operating Cleaning the Interior Clean the inside walls and accessories with a mild detergent and then wipe dry with a soft cloth. You can remove the drawers and shelves for a more thorough cleaning. Just make sure to dry drawers and shelves before putting them back into place. Cleaning the Exterior Wipe the display panel with a damp, clean and soft cloth.
